Femoral hernia treatment in Indore focuses on repairing a rare but potentially serious hernia that occurs just below the groin, where abdominal tissue pushes through the femoral canal near the thigh. Femoral hernias are more common in women and can sometimes lead to complications like bowel obstruction or strangulation if left untreated. Patients may notice a small bulge near the upper thigh or groin, which can become more prominent while standing, lifting, or coughing. Discomfort, groin pain, or nausea may also occur. In severe cases, vomiting and intense pain may signal a trapped hernia that requires emergency surgery. Risk factors include pregnancy, obesity, chronic coughing, frequent heavy lifting, and previous abdominal surgery.

Minimally invasive surgery offers smaller incisions, less postoperative pain, reduced complications, and a faster return to normal activities compared to open surgery.
